Yes, you can set up a VPN client on your Unifi Dream Machine UDM to secure all devices on your network with a single configuration. In this guide, I’ll walk you through a step-by-step process, share tips, and keep things practical so you can get protection without headaches. We’ll cover why you’d want a VPN client on the UDM, how to choose a provider, and how to actually configure it, plus a quick troubleshooting checklist. If you’re curious about a quick win, I’ve included a few tested tips that save time and avoid common misconfigurations. And if you want extra protection, you can pair this with a reputable VPN service like NordVPN—use this link to check it out: NordVPN.
Introduction and quick overview
- What you’ll learn: how to set up a VPN client on the UDM, what settings to use, and how to verify the connection.
- Why it matters: a VPN on the router protects every device, from phones to smart TVs, without needing to configure each one.
- What you’ll need: a VPN service that supports OpenVPN or WireGuard, a Ubiquiti Unifi Dream Machine, and admin access to the Unifi Network Controller.
- What you’ll get: a working VPN client on the UDM, a solid fail-safe to test, and a troubleshooting checklist.
What a VPN client on the UDM does for you
- Whole-network protection: all devices route traffic through the VPN without app-level setup.
- Consistent security posture: standardized encryption and routing for every device.
- Easier management: fewer credentials to manage across devices, centralized VPN control.
- Some caveats: potential slowdowns on devices with heavy traffic, and Netflix/streaming blocks can vary by provider.
Top considerations before you begin
- VPN protocol: OpenVPN vs WireGuard. WireGuard is faster and simpler to configure on many setups, but not all providers support it with UI-based routers. OpenVPN is more widely supported but may be a tad slower.
- DNS leakage: ensure DNS requests route through the VPN tunnel to avoid leaking your ISP’s DNS.
- Kill switch: check if your VPN supports a kill switch or if you need a fallback policy to prevent leaks if the tunnel drops.
- Split tunneling: decide if you want all traffic to go through the VPN or only specific devices/applications.
- Provider compatibility: some VPNs offer preconfigured .ovpn files or per-device profiles that work best with OpenVPN; others support WireGuard via VPN servers or custom configs.
Choosing a VPN provider for router use
- Look for OpenVPN and WireGuard support, clear router setup docs, and reliable tunneling performance.
- Check for a router-friendly knowledge base and live chat support in case you hit a snag.
- Confirm server coverage in your preferred locations for streaming, gaming, or remote work.
- Review price, simultaneous connections, and whether there’s a money-back guarantee.
Step-by-step setup OpenVPN on UDM
Note: The exact menu labels can vary slightly depending on firmware and the Unifi Network app version. If you see something different, look for similar wording like “VPN,” “Settings,” or “Remote Access.”
- Prepare your VPN configuration from the provider
- If you’re using OpenVPN, download the .ovpn file and any certificate/key files from your VPN provider’s website.
- If your provider gives separate certificates and keys, keep them handy. You’ll need them for the UDM.
- Access the Unifi Dream Machine UI
- Open the Unifi Network app or the web UI and log in with admin credentials.
- Navigate to Settings > VPN > VPN Client the exact path might be “Settings” > “Networks” or “Advanced” depending on your version.
- Create a VPN client network
- Choose “Add VPN” or “Create VPN Client.”
- Select the VPN type: OpenVPN is common; WireGuard may appear as a separate option if supported.
- For OpenVPN:
- Upload or paste the .ovpn file contents.
- If you’re prompted for certificate or key data, provide the necessary PEM-formatted content from your provider.
- Enter any required authentication data username/password if your provider uses it.
- For WireGuard if available:
- You’ll typically enter a peer’s public key, endpoint, allowed IPs, and a persistent keepalive. Your provider should supply these details.
- Set routing and DNS options
- Ensure “Use VPN as default gateway” or “Force all traffic through VPN” is enabled if you want all devices to go through the VPN.
- Enable DNS through VPN if available to prevent DNS leaks.
- If you want split tunneling, configure the routes or policies to exclude local LAN traffic or specific destinations.
- Save and apply
- Save the configuration, then apply or reboot the Dream Machine if prompted.
- The VPN client should show as connected in the VPN section.
- Verify the connection
- Check the VPN status in the UDM UI; you should see an active connection.
- Use a device on your network to visit a site like whatismyipaddress.com to confirm the IP address appears as the VPN endpoint.
- Test DNS routing by visiting a site that reveals DNS information and ensure it shows the VPN’s DNS server.
Step-by-step setup WireGuard on UDM
- If your provider supports WireGuard, you’ll usually get a config snippet or keypair data.
- In the UDM UI, select WireGuard as VPN type and input:
- Public key
- Private key generated by the UDM or provided
- Peer server public key and endpoint
- Allowed IPs typically 0.0.0.0/0 for all traffic
- Persistent keepalive commonly 25 seconds
- Save, apply, and verify similarly to the OpenVPN steps.
Common pitfalls and quick fixes
- Firewall blocks: Some ISPs or networks block VPN ports. If you’re having trouble, switch servers or ports if your provider supports it.
- DNS leaks: If test shows your real DNS, re-check DNS settings in the VPN config or enable the VPN’s DNS routing option.
- Double NAT issues: If you’re behind a modem-router combo, ensure the UDM is in bridge mode or set up correctly to avoid double NAT issues that can disrupt VPN routing.
- Server availability: VPN endpoints go up and down; keep a list of alternate servers handy.
Advanced tips for power users
- Kill switch: If your provider and UDM support it, enable a VPN kill switch to prevent traffic if the VPN drops.
- Auto-connect on boot: Enable the VPN to reconnect automatically when the UDM restarts or when the WAN comes back online.
- Split tunneling for specific devices: Use device or group-based routing rules to ensure only certain devices use the VPN, preserving local network access for others.
- Bonded connections: If you have multiple WANs, you can route VPN traffic through a specific WAN interface for stability.
Security best practices
- Regularly update firmware: Keep the UDM and Unifi Controller up to date to benefit from security improvements.
- Strong credentials: Use a strong admin password and enable two-factor authentication on your Unifi account.
- VPN provider hygiene: Choose a VPN provider with a solid no-logs policy, transparent audits, and good privacy practices.
- Monitor for leaks: Periodically verify IP and DNS leakage using trusted tools and websites.
Performance and metrics you can rely on
- Latency impact: Expect a small increase in latency due to encryption and routing; WireGuard generally keeps latency lower than OpenVPN.
- Throughput: VPN encryption reduces raw throughput by some margin; experienced users report 5–15% to 50% loss depending on protocol and server distance.
- Server load: Choose nearby VPN servers to minimize round-trip time and keep speeds up.
Comparison: OpenVPN vs WireGuard on UDM
- OpenVPN:
- Pros: Widely supported, robust, easier for providers without WireGuard configs.
- Cons: Slightly slower, more CPU-intensive on some devices.
- WireGuard:
- Pros: Faster, leaner codebase, easier to configure with modern setups.
- Cons: Not always available from every provider in router-friendly formats; some providers require manual configuration.
Maintenance and monitoring
- Check VPN status weekly to ensure the tunnel is alive.
- Review router logs for VPN-related errors or disconnects.
- Update VPN credentials if your provider rotates keys or certificates.
Troubleshooting quick checklist
- VPN shows disconnected? Re-check credentials and re-upload config.
- No internet after VPN connects? Double-check DNS routing and default gateway settings.
- Slow speeds? Switch to a closer server, try WireGuard if available, and ensure hardware acceleration is enabled if your device supports it.
- Devices can’t reach local network? Verify split tunneling rules and LAN access settings.
Real-world scenario: family home with multiple devices
- You want every device to be protected by the VPN without manually configuring each device.
- You choose a provider with both OpenVPN and WireGuard support for flexibility.
- You enable “Force all traffic through VPN” on the UDM and set VPN DNS to avoid leaks.
- You keep a separate, non-VPN VLAN for smart home devices that don’t need VPN access, if your router supports it.
Monitoring and analytics to look at
- VPN uptime percentage per month.
- Average latency to VPN servers by location helps you pick the best servers.
- Bandwidth usage per VPN client helps you understand if any devices are hogging traffic.
FAQ section
Frequently Asked Questions
Can I use a VPN on my Unifi Dream Machine without a separate VPN app?
Yes, you can configure a VPN client directly on the Dream Machine, which protects every device on your network without needing individual apps.
Which VPN protocol is better for Unifi Dream Machine: OpenVPN or WireGuard?
WireGuard is typically faster and simpler, but not all providers support it on routers. OpenVPN is more widely supported across providers but can be slower.
Will using a VPN on the router slow down my internet?
Yes, encryption and routing introduce some overhead. The impact varies by protocol, server distance, and hardware. WireGuard often performs better than OpenVPN.
How do I test if my VPN is working correctly?
Check your public IP on whatismyipaddress.com to ensure it reflects the VPN server’s location, and test for DNS leaks by visiting a site like dnsleaktest.com.
Can I have split tunneling with a VPN on the UDM?
Some providers and firmware versions support it. You can configure routing rules to allow local LAN traffic for specific devices while others go through the VPN. Nordvpn Review 2026 Is It Still Your Best Bet for Speed and Security
Can I use multiple VPN providers on the same UDM?
Not simultaneously in standard setups. You’d typically pick one provider per tunnel, though you can switch between profiles or configure multiple VPNs for different networks.
How do I update my VPN credentials on the UDM?
Edit the VPN client network in the Unifi Controller, update the necessary certificate, key, or credentials, then save and re-connect.
Should I enable a kill switch on my UDM VPN?
If your provider supports it, enabling a kill switch helps prevent traffic leaks if the VPN drops.
How do I verify there are no DNS leaks?
Use a DNS leak test site or verify that DNS lookups resolve through the VPN provider’s DNS servers, not your ISP’s.
What if my VPN won’t connect after a firmware update?
Check for updated provider configurations, re-import the OpenVPN file or WireGuard keys, and confirm you’re on a compatible VPN profile for your Unifi version. How to use nordvpn in china on your iphone or ipad: Fast, Practical Guide to Bypass China’s Great Firewall
Useful resources and references
- NordVPN – NordVPN official page for router setups
- Unifi Network Controller – Official Unifi documentation and forums
- VPN provider knowledge bases for OpenVPN and WireGuard configurations
- WhatIsMyIP: IP address check and DNS leakage tests
- DNSLeakTest: DNS leakage testing site
- Wikipedia: WireGuard overview
- The OpenVPN project: OpenVPN setup and configuration
- Ubiquiti Community Forums: Real-world user experiences and troubleshooting
Note: If you’re new to VPNs or want a quick answer, consider starting with a trusted provider that has strong router support and a solid guide for Unifi Dream Machine. You can explore options and try a top-tier VPN service with this affiliate link as a convenient starting point: NordVPN.
Sources:
Globalprotect vpn not connecting on windows 11 heres how to fix it
The absolute best vpn for wuwa in 2025 boost your game stay secure
Vpn for chinese phone 在中国使用VPN的完整指南与实用技巧 Where is nordvpn really based unpacking the hq and why it matters